The Czech Republic The  Czech national anthem is called where is my home  The Czech Republic  Decomposes into three parts - Bohemia, Moravia and Silesia - the area of 78,867 square kilometers  and population is 10,8milion people  It is divided into 14 separate regions
Capital city is Prague  The current president is V á clav Klaus  The highest mountain is S něž ka, it  has 1602m.n.m  The Czech currency is Czech crown     The Czechoslovak Republic was founded 1918 and ceased in 1993
Karlovy Vary ( Carlsbad ) This town has 53,907 inhabitants and an area of 59.10 km ² It is an important spa resort with the famous glass and food industries.
